Health Promotion and Maintenance Practice Question

Question

The nurse is caring for a parent of a toddler and is focused on newborn care scenario 6. Which nursing action is most appropriate?

Answer choices

  1. A. Delay assessment until the next scheduled round if the client is not calling for help.
  2. B. Delegate the clinical assessment and nursing judgment to assistive personnel.
  3. C. Document the concern without notifying the appropriate provider or care team member when escalation is needed.
  4. D. Teach safe sleep, feeding cues, and signs requiring urgent evaluation.

Correct Answer

D. Teach safe sleep, feeding cues, and signs requiring urgent evaluation.

Explanation

The priority action for newborn care is to teach safe sleep, feeding cues, and signs requiring urgent evaluation. NCLEX-style prioritization favors safety, assessment, appropriate delegation, timely escalation, and client-centered teaching.
